9.8 Options for test strips
This menu allows you to select options for handling lot
numbers and specify whether the operator is allowed to
add or delete reagent lots, edit the expiration date and
limit values on the meter (see “Creating a setup pass-
word” on page 142).
1 Touch the desired option to enable it:
Reagent Editing
Allowed: Enables the operator to edit the reagent
information without needing a password.
Password Needed: Enables the operator to edit the
reagent information only after entering a password.
Not Allowed: The operator cannot edit reagent
information.
Strip Lot Verification
Display only: The lot number is shown on screen but
the operator cannot confirm it or select a different
lot number.
Confirmation: The operator must confirm the lot
number displayed and can enter alternative lot
numbers manually or via barcode scanner.
List selection: The operator can also select from a
list of stored lot numbers.
Scan only: Lot numbers can be verified via barcode
scanner only.
2 Touch to change to the second screen of
options,
or
touch to exit this menu without saving any
changes.
When using a data management system for configura-
tion, it is possible to fully disable the Reagent Editing
option.

Accu-Chek Inform II Specifications

General IconGeneral
Sample Size0.6 µL
Test Time5 seconds
Memory Capacity1000 test results
DisplayLCD
Measurement Range10 to 600 mg/dL
ConnectivityInfrared
Sample TypeCapillary whole blood
Operating Temperature16 to 32°C (61 to 90°F)
Relative Humidity10 to 90% non-condensing
